string类型转list实体类集合
controller层用@RequestParam Map<String, Object> params接收前端传值,例如

    @RequestMapping("/test")public List<Entity> tset(@RequestParam Map<String, Object> params){
List<Entity> list= (List<Entity>) params.get("Entity");return list;}

转换时会报错:String cannot be cast to java.util.List
解决方法:
使用阿里的fastjson
List list = JSON.parseArray(“你的json字符串”, Model.class); (Model是你的实体)

List<Entity> list= JSON.parseArray(params.get("Entity").toString(), Entity.class);

解决String cannot be cast to java.util.List报错相关推荐

  1. 记录---ClassCastException: java.util.Date cannot be cast to java.sql.Date报错解决方法

    记录-ClassCastException: java.util.Date cannot be cast to java.sql.Date报错解决方法 先po代码: //1.读取配置文件中的基本信息I ...

  2. nested exception is java.lang.ClassCastException: java.lang String cannot be cast to java.util.Map

    今天来此记录下自己犯了多次的错误,就是在本地服务起了之后,在页面点击看效果报错,页面显示异常,后端报错,如下: falied to handle or send message;nested exce ...

  3. Set遍历解决java.util.NoSuchElementException报错问题

    出现问题:在遍历Set集合时,使用到了迭代器.项目运行时报错:java.util.NoSuchElementException 报错原因:itr本身只有两个值,而itr.next()两次,没有值可取导 ...

  4. import java.util.Objects;报错。错误信息为: Objects cannot be resolved

    import java.util.Objects;报错 错误信息为: Objects cannot be resolved 原因:jre版本问题,JDK1.7.0才有Objects类 解决办法: 在M ...

  5. java.util.list 报错_Java 报错 .updateValue' has an unsupported return type: interface java.util.List...

    问题描述 org.apache.ibatis.binding.BindingException: Mapper method****updateValue' has an unsupported re ...

  6. java 循环删除hashmap中的键值对,解决java.util.ConcurrentModificationException报错

    示例 import java.util.HashMap; import java.util.Iterator; import java.util.Map;public class DeleteHash ...

  7. java.util.base64报错解决

    java.util.Base64 这个类,它是在 JDK 1.8 的时候加入的,之前版本的标准库没有这个类. eclipse更换jdk1.8就可以了了. 转载于:https://www.cnblogs ...

  8. 已解决java.lang.ClassCastException: java.util.ArrayList cannot be cast to java.util.Map异常的正确解决方法,亲测有效!!

    已解决java.lang.ClassCastException: java.util.ArrayList cannot be cast to java.util.Map异常的正确解决方法,亲测有效!! ...

  9. ArrayMap java.lang.ClassCastException: java.lang.String cannot be cast to java.lang.Object[]

    错误堆栈: java.lang.ClassCastException: java.lang.String cannot be cast to java.lang.Object[]at android. ...

最新文章

  1. oracle 手动批处理,Oracle 简单备份 批处理(BAT)
  2. e2e测试框架之Cypress
  3. spring cloud微服务分布式云架构-Gateway入门
  4. zoj4062 Plants vs. Zombies 二分+模拟(贪心的思维)
  5. php 查找无限级,Ztree + PHP 无限级节点 递归查找节点法
  6. Lua-泛型for循环 pairs和ipairs的区别
  7. Python:遍历指定目录下所有的c语言源代码文件
  8. 27. Remove Element[E]移除元素
  9. 创建一个MDK工程模板
  10. 2021-11-09
  11. python爬虫淘宝视频_python爬虫视频教程:一篇文章教会你用Python爬取淘宝评论数据...
  12. eclipse jade插件安装
  13. 编译原理实验之词法分析
  14. VC++6.0出现error spawning解决方法
  15. 大咖云集!9月18日 Imagination Technologies 受邀参加2020中关村论坛
  16. Log4net自定义信息(变量或属性或字段)存入数据库
  17. android 获得顶层窗口_android 获取当前activity的最顶层及添加布局
  18. “短信轰炸”克星 ,“无感”AI立体防御完美解决方案
  19. Excel CPK “逆公式“
  20. 切换双系统ubuntu使用的显卡

热门文章

  1. Swift 优化OC接口 NS_REFINED_FOR_SWIFT
  2. php的常见加密方式,记录接口中常见的简单内容加密方式:恺撒加密的PHP实现
  3. android 高德地图poi搜索周边
  4. C语言abs函数与fabs函数,函数abs 和fabs
  5. 苹果手机开热点电脑/安卓手机无法链接?
  6. 分析方法10---AARRR模型分析方法
  7. wps自动插入文献_WPS中怎样自动生成参考文献?方法超级简单!
  8. 基于卡方分布的独立性检验
  9. 数据众包平台Premise持续向美军提供情报数据
  10. 初学者吉他怎么选?适合男女生新手吉他入门品牌推荐!